Output 615dbfe205177a96f18cb1b326d85b570f07efe2ae2cace2d2f21802878f74b7:0

value
3414249600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db24451513694dd859854e39a79a571b3fc011e61bb8070607c36784110cc5fe
address
tb1pmvjy29gnd9xaskv9fcu60xjhrvluqy0xrwuqwps8cdncgygvchlqge2knv
transaction
615dbfe205177a96f18cb1b326d85b570f07efe2ae2cace2d2f21802878f74b7